A slugger's paradise

Article Abstract:

Hillerich and Bradsby's Louisville Slugger is a type of baseball bat that has been used by famous professional and amateur players alike. The company's factory and museum, known as the Louisville Slugger Museum and Visiting Centers, displays bats made in the past and those being made today.

Of Wilmington and the River

Article Abstract:

Wilmington, NC, is a historic port city which offers visitors a variety of attractions. Its historic look has attracted movie makers, and several motion pictures have in fact been shot in the city.
